STATEMENT OF FAIRPOINT COMMUNICATIONS

FairPoint has a proven record of open communications with its shareholders and welcomes input toward the goal of improving long-term value. We have engaged in a longstanding dialogue with Maglan, including numerous discussions between Maglan and members of our Board and management team and a presentation by Maglan to the full Board of Directors in August. We are pleased with our significant progress executing on our four pillar strategy to enhance sustainable value for all FairPoint shareholders and we will continue to act in the best interests of FairPoint and its stakeholders.
